Abstract
The invention relates to an ultrasonic extraction bottle, which consists of a bottle stopper, a movable bottle neck, a silica gel gasket, filter paper and an extraction bottle body. The ultrasonic extraction bottle has an ingenious design, a special shape, a simple and practical structure and low cost, and is suitable for popularization. Due to the movable bottle neck structure, the filter paper can be conveniently replaced. The filter paper is clamped in the bottle, so that a sample in the bottle is prevented from being taken out when extract is poured, the ultrasonic extraction operation steps are reduced, and work efficiency is improved.

Background technology
During organic component in analyzing biological, soil and some solid products, at first need to carry out the extraction of organic component.At present, Chang Yong extracting method has Soxhlet extraction, ultrasonic extraction and accelerated solvent extraction.The Soxhlet extractive technique is to utilize solvent refluxing and siphon principle, and solid matter is constantly come out by solvent extraction.This method is simple to operate, extraction efficiency height but required time is longer, and handling a batch sample needs more than 24 hours.Ultrasonic extraction is effects such as the strong cavitation effect that utilizes the ultrasonic wave radiation pressure to produce, mechanical oscillation, increases the motion frequency and the speed of material, thereby promotes the carrying out of extracting.Advantages such as this method has efficiently, the time spent is short.Accelerated solvent extraction also possesses the advantage of ultrasonic extraction, but equipment price is very high, should not promote.
At present, the most widely used method of liquid-solid extraction is ultrasonic extraction, in real work, this method needs to merge extract after the repeated ultrasonic, usually extraction flask is toppled over filtration, collects filtrate, solid in the extraction flask very easily flows out with extract, at this moment need and will extract behind the withdrawal of the residual solids on the filter paper extraction flask next time, operation has increased workload like this, and loses time.(list of references, [1] Zhang Lanying, Rao Zhu, Liu Na.Environmental sample pretreatment technology [M].Beijing, publishing house of Tsing-Hua University, 2008.[2] Wang Li, Wang Zhengfan, Mu Shifen, Ding Xiaojing.Chromatography sample treatment [M].Beijing, Chemical Industry Press, 2001.)
Summary of the invention
The purpose of this invention is to provide ultrasonic extraction flask, thereby easily flow out and increase workload and problem such as lose time with solvent to solve solid in the extraction flask.
Ultrasonic extraction flask of the present invention is made of bottle stopper, movable bottleneck, silicone gasket, filter paper, extraction bottle;
Described bottle stopper, movable bottleneck, extraction bottle all adopt glass to make;
Bottle stopper top is cylindrical, and the bottom is truncated cone-shaped and has the standard ground;
The standard ground corresponding with the bottle stopper bottom arranged at movable bottleneck top, movable base of neck is a truncated cone-shaped, be threaded below it, the top of extracting bottle also is threaded, and movable bottleneck closely compresses silicone gasket and following filter paper thereof after bottle closely links to each other by screw thread with extracting.
During work, movable bottleneck is unloaded, and pack in extracting bottle sample and extraction solvent are placed on filter paper on the upper grinding port that extracts bottle earlier, movable bottleneck is tightened, movable bottleneck closely compresses silicone gasket and following filter paper thereof after bottle closely links to each other by screw thread with extracting again.Then, cover bottle stopper, ultrasonic extraction flask is placed in the ultrasonic cleaning machine extract; After the extraction, open bottle stopper, slowly topple over extract, the extract after filtering through filter paper is poured in another container, and solids is intercepted in extracting bottle by filter paper; Slowly pour the extraction solvent into along movable bottleneck sidewall suitable for reading again, extract next time.
Beneficial effect: (1) ultrasonic extraction flask provided by the invention, design ingeniously, shape is special, and is simple and practical, and cost is lower, is suitable for popularization.(2) owing to adopted movable bottleneck structure, can change filter paper easily.(3) the present invention adopts the method for folder filter paper in the bottle to prevent to topple over extract sample in the bottle is taken out of, has reduced the step of ultrasonic extraction operation, has improved operating efficiency.
